The highly anticipated suspense thriller Drishyam 3, starring superstar Mohanlal, has experienced its first major shift in business during its second day in theatres. Directed by Jeethu Joseph, the film made a roaring debut at the box office on its first day, largely fueled by the immense hype surrounding the franchise and its release coinciding with the lead actor’s birthday. However, as it hit its first working Friday, the domestic earnings saw a noticeable drop of over thirty percent. According to the early trade reports, the film managed to gather around 10.85 crore rupees net across India on its second day, which brought its total two-day domestic collection to approximately 26.70 crore rupees. While a dip on a regular weekday is common for major releases, industry experts are closely tracking how the audience word-of-mouth will shape up over the coming weekend.
Despite the drop in domestic numbers, the movie continues to pull in a massive audience globally, especially in overseas markets like the Gulf region, North America, and the United Kingdom where the previous installments built a dedicated fan base. On its opening day, the third part of the franchise registered an incredible worldwide gross, making it one of the top openers for Malayalam cinema. The story line continues to follow the journey of Georgekutty and his family as they face new threats tied to their past actions, bringing back familiar cast members like Meena, Ansiba Hassan, and Esther Anil. While the film has received mixed reactions from critics who feel the narrative leans more heavily on slow-burn family drama rather than fast-paced twists, fans of the superstar have shown immense love for his understated performance. The producers are looking forward to a significant jump in numbers during Saturday and Sunday, as families and thriller enthusiasts head out to catch the latest chapter of this iconic cinematic saga.
